We are regularly facing problems in almost all 40GB Seagate hard drives (5400 and 7200 rpm versions). The problem is:
1. While running FDisk, the partitions appear to have been formed properly, but after a reboot, the logical partitions disappears and we are required to redo the logical partitions.
2. At times, even redoing logical partition fails and the hard drive shows less space than rated.
3. Under FDisk, the invisible logical partition if tried to remove, does not get removed, however, the size of the virtual logical drive is missing from the total hard drive capacity.
